Wu C, Ikejiri Y, Zeng X, Elsegood MRJ, Redshaw C, Yamato T. Synthesis of Mono-O-alkylated Homooxacalix[3]arene and a Protection-Deprotection Strategy for Homooxacalix[3]arene. Org Lett 2017; 19:66-69. [PMID: 27936785 DOI: 10.1021/acs.orglett.6b03338] [Citation(s) in RCA: 8] [Impact Index Per Article: 1.1]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 11/28/2022]
Abstract
The regioselective synthesis of mono-O-alkylated homooxacalix[3]arene is accomplished for the first time. The synthetic route relies on two key steps: (i) a facile protection of two OH groups at the lower rim of the homooxacalix[3]arene and (ii) the deprotection of 9-anthrylmethyl groups via the Pd/C-catalyzed hydrogenation under atmospheric hydrogen. An efficient protection-deprotection strategy for the functionalization of homooxacalix[3]arene is presented.

Reddy GNM, Huqi A, Iuga D, Sakurai S, Marsh A, Davis JT, Masiero S, Brown SP. Co-existence of Distinct Supramolecular Assemblies in Solution and in the Solid State. Chemistry 2016; 23:2315-2322. [PMID: 27897351 PMCID: PMC5396329 DOI: 10.1002/chem.201604832] [Citation(s) in RCA: 20] [Impact Index Per Article: 2.5]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Key Words] [Track Full Text] [Download PDF] [Figures]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Received: 10/14/2016] [Indexed: 11/24/2022]
Abstract
The formation of distinct supramolecular assemblies, including a metastable species, is revealed for a lipophilic guanosine (G) derivative in solution and in the solid state. Structurally different G‐quartet‐based assemblies are formed in chloroform depending on the nature of the cation, anion and the salt concentration, as characterized by circular dichroism and time course diffusion‐ordered NMR spectroscopy data. Intriguingly, even the presence of potassium ions that stabilize G‐quartets in chloroform was insufficient to exclusively retain such assemblies in the solid state, leading to the formation of mixed quartet and ribbon‐like assemblies as revealed by fast magic‐angle spinning (MAS) NMR spectroscopy. Distinct N−H⋅⋅⋅N and N−H⋅⋅⋅O intermolecular hydrogen bonding interactions drive quartet and ribbon‐like self‐assembly resulting in markedly different 2D 1H solid‐state NMR spectra, thus facilitating a direct identification of mixed assemblies. A dissolution NMR experiment confirmed that the quartet and ribbon interconversion is reversible–further demonstrating the changes that occur in the self‐assembly process of a lipophilic nucleoside upon a solid‐state to solution‐state transition and vice versa. A systematic study for complexation with different cations (K+, Sr2+) and anions (picrate, ethanoate and iodide) emphasizes that the existence of a stable solution or solid‐state structure may not reflect the stability of the same supramolecular entity in another phase.

Echabaane M, Rouis A, Bonnamour I, Ben Ouada H. Studies of aluminum (III) ion-selective optical sensor based on a chromogenic calix[4]arene derivative. SPECTROCHIMICA ACTA. PART A, MOLECULAR AND BIOMOLECULAR SPECTROSCOPY 2013; 115:269-274. [PMID: 23845984 DOI: 10.1016/j.saa.2013.06.053] [Citation(s) in RCA: 11] [Impact Index Per Article: 1.0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Key Words]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Received: 09/26/2012] [Revised: 06/07/2013] [Accepted: 06/13/2013] [Indexed: 06/02/2023]
Abstract
An optical chemical sensor based on azo-calix[4]arene derivative is developed for the determination of aluminum (III) ions in aqueous solutions. The complex formation ability of azo-calix[4]arene toward metal cations such as Li(I), Cs(I), K(I), Sn(II), Pb(II), Cu(II), Eu(III), Er(III) and Al(III) is investigated by UV-vis spectroscopy. Assessments of results reveal that the azo-calix[4]arene derivative has high affinity to Al(III). The stoichiometric ratio and the association constant were determined as 1:1 and 1.24×10(4)M(-1), respectively for the complex between Al(3+) and the azo-calix[4]arene. The sensing film is fabricated by spin coating on glass plates. Under the optimized conditions, at pH 6.8, the proposed optical sensor displays a linear response to Al(3+) over 10(-7) to 10(-5)M range with response time of 12min. The optical sensor can be regenerated with HNO3 solution. In addition to its high stability and reproducibility, the sensor shows good selectivity for Al(3+) ion.

Lewis FW, Harwood LM, Hudson MJ, Drew MGB, Sypula M, Modolo G, Whittaker D, Sharrad CA, Videva V, Hubscher-Bruder V, Arnaud-Neu F. Complexation of lanthanides, actinides and transition metal cations with a 6-(1,2,4-triazin-3-yl)-2,2':6',2''-terpyridine ligand: implications for actinide(III)/lanthanide(III) partitioning. Dalton Trans 2012; 41:9209-19. [PMID: 22729349 DOI: 10.1039/c2dt30522d] [Citation(s) in RCA: 37] [Impact Index Per Article: 3.1]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 11/21/2022]
Abstract
The quadridentate N-heterocyclic ligand 6-(5,5,8,8-tetramethyl-5,6,7,8-tetrahydro-1,2,4-benzotriazin-3-yl)-2,2' : 6',2''-terpyridine (CyMe(4)-hemi-BTBP) has been synthesized and its interactions with Am(III), U(VI), Ln(III) and some transition metal cations have been evaluated by X-ray crystallographic analysis, Am(III)/Eu(III) solvent extraction experiments, UV absorption spectrophotometry, NMR studies and ESI-MS. Structures of 1:1 complexes with Eu(III), Ce(III) and the linear uranyl (UO(2)(2+)) ion were obtained by X-ray crystallographic analysis, and they showed similar coordination behavior to related BTBP complexes. In methanol, the stability constants of the Ln(III) complexes are slightly lower than those of the analogous quadridentate bis-triazine BTBP ligands, while the stability constant for the Yb(III) complex is higher. (1)H NMR titrations and ESI-MS with lanthanide nitrates showed that the ligand forms only 1:1 complexes with Eu(III), Ce(III) and Yb(III), while both 1:1 and 1:2 complexes were formed with La(III) and Y(III) in acetonitrile. A mixture of isomeric chiral 2:2 helical complexes was formed with Cu(I), with a slight preference (1.4:1) for a single directional isomer. In contrast, a 1:1 complex was observed with the larger Ag(I) ion. The ligand was unable to extract Am(III) or Eu(III) from nitric acid solutions into 1-octanol, except in the presence of a synergist at low acidity. The results show that the presence of two outer 1,2,4-triazine rings is required for the efficient extraction and separation of An(III) from Ln(III) by quadridentate N-donor ligands.

Cottet K, Marcos PM, Cragg PJ. Fifty years of oxacalix[3]arenes: A review. Beilstein J Org Chem 2012; 8:201-26. [PMID: 22423288 PMCID: PMC3302082 DOI: 10.3762/bjoc.8.22] [Citation(s) in RCA: 62] [Impact Index Per Article: 5.2]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Key Words] [Track Full Text] [Download PDF] [Figures]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Received: 10/15/2011] [Accepted: 01/11/2012] [Indexed: 01/19/2023] Open
Abstract
Hexahomotrioxacalix[3]arenes, commonly called oxacalix[3]arenes, were first reported in 1962. Since then, their chemistry has been expanded to include numerous derivatives and complexes. This review describes the syntheses of the parent compounds, their derivatives, and their complexation behaviour towards cations. Extraction data are presented, as are crystal structures of the macrocycles and their complexes with guest species. Applications in fields as diverse as ion selective electrode modifiers, fluorescence sensors, fullerene separations and biomimetic chemistry are described.

Ni XL, Zeng X, Redshaw C, Yamato T. Ratiometric fluorescent receptors for both Zn2+ and H2PO4(-) ions based on a pyrenyl-linked triazole-modified homooxacalix[3]arene: a potential molecular traffic signal with an R-S latch logic circuit. J Org Chem 2011; 76:5696-702. [PMID: 21630671 DOI: 10.1021/jo2007303] [Citation(s) in RCA: 91] [Impact Index Per Article: 7.0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Journal Information]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 01/30/2023]
Abstract
A ratiometric fluorescent receptor with a C(3) symmetric structure based on a pyrene-linked triazole-modified homooxacalix[3]arene (L) was synthesized and characterized. This system exhibited an interesting ratiometric detection signal output for targeting cations and anions through switching the excimer emission of pyrene from the "on-off" to the "off-on" type in neutral solution. (1)H NMR titration results suggested that the Zn(2+) center of receptor L·Zn(2+) provided an excellent pathway of organizing anion binding groups for optimal host-guest interactions. It is thus believed that this receptor has potential application in sensing, detection, and recognition of both Zn(2+) and H(2)PO(4)(-) ions with different optical signals. In addition, the fluorescence emission changes by the inputs of Zn(2+) and H(2)PO(4)(-) ions can be viewed as a combinational R-S latch logic circuit at the molecular level.
